A Study of Chidamide Plus Endocrine in Maintenance Treatment of HR+/HER2- Breast Cancer Af
To explore the efficacy and safety of Chidamide combined with endocrine for maintenance therapy after first-line chemotherapy for HR+/HER2- breast cancer
